D24214: fix default version selection to allow for renamed "unspecified" versions
Harald Sitter
noreply at phabricator.kde.org
Wed Sep 25 11:30:31 BST 2019
sitter created this revision.
sitter added a reviewer: Plasma.
Herald added a project: Plasma.
Herald added a subscriber: plasma-devel.
sitter requested review of this revision.
REVISION SUMMARY
plasmashell for example has a "master" instead of "unspecified". if we
still tried to file a bug against "unspecified" bugzilla will throw rather
unhelpful errors. instead as a fallback to finding a "proper" version, make
sure to set the "default" to something sane. if the hardcoded default
doesn't map to an actual version as per the API we pick the lowest possible
id and file against that instead. seeing as you cannot remove versions this
should technically be the "unspecified" version no matter what it was
renamed to.
BUG: 411983
TEST PLAN
can file bugs against plasmashell even when kcrash passed an empty or unmapped version
REPOSITORY
R871 DrKonqi
BRANCH
Plasma/5.17
REVISION DETAIL
https://phabricator.kde.org/D24214
AFFECTED FILES
src/bugzillaintegration/productmapping.cpp
To: sitter, #plasma
Cc: plasma-devel, LeGast00n, The-Feren-OS-Dev, jraleigh, fbampaloukas, GB_2, ragreen, ZrenBot, alexeymin, himcesjf,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20190925/bf77f483/attachment.html>
More information about the Plasma-devel
mailing list